### What is a Business Travel Agency?


A business travel agency is a specialized service provider that focuses on managing and organizing travel arrangements for companies and their employees. Unlike regular travel agencies that cater to leisure travel, business travel agencies understand the unique needs and priorities of corporate clients. They help businesses plan and coordinate every aspect of travel, from booking flights and accommodations to managing travel expenses, handling changes, and ensuring compliance with company policies.


Business travel agencies offer a range of services designed to save time, money, and resources for businesses, while ensuring employees have a seamless travel experience. They use advanced technology to streamline processes, provide personalized service, and offer insights into travel trends, helping companies make informed decisions about their travel programs.


### The Benefits of Using a Professional Business Travel Agency


#### 1. **Cost Savings**


One of the most significant benefits of partnering with a business travel agency is cost savings. These agencies have access to discounted rates, special offers, and travel deals that may not be available to individuals or companies booking travel on their own. By leveraging their relationships with airlines, hotels, and car rental services, travel agencies can secure better prices and reduce overall travel expenses for businesses.


In addition to discounted rates, business travel agencies can help businesses save money by implementing cost-control measures. For example, agencies can track and analyze travel spending to identify areas where savings can be made, such as booking in advance, choosing less expensive accommodations, or consolidating travel itineraries to maximize efficiency.


#### 2. **Expert Travel Management**


Corporate travel can be complicated, with numerous logistics to consider, such as flight schedules, hotel bookings, transportation arrangements, and travel itineraries. A professional travel agency specializes in managing these details, ensuring that all travel arrangements are made according to your company’s needs and preferences.


From understanding your company’s travel policies to recommending the best options for your employees’ specific needs, a business travel agency ensures smooth coordination. They also have the experience to navigate any potential travel disruptions, such as flight cancellations or delays, and can quickly find alternative solutions to keep business operations on track.


#### 3. **Time Efficiency**


Managing corporate travel can consume valuable time, especially for businesses that need to book travel frequently. Having an internal team manage this process can be a logistical nightmare, leading to wasted time spent on researching flights, comparing prices, coordinating with vendors, and organizing itineraries.


By outsourcing travel management to a professional business travel agency, your company can free up valuable time for your employees. The agency will handle all the time-consuming tasks associated with corporate travel, allowing your team to focus on more important business priorities. The agency will also provide personalized travel itineraries, making it easier for employees to access their travel details in one place.


#### 4. **24/7 Support and Assistance**


One of the key advantages of working with a business travel agency is having access to round-the-clock support. Whether it’s a last-minute flight change, an issue with accommodations, or a sudden travel emergency, a professional agency can provide immediate assistance to resolve issues swiftly and efficiently.


Business travel agencies offer dedicated support to handle any travel-related problems that arise, ensuring that employees are never left stranded or confused about their travel arrangements. This can be especially important for international business trips, where time zones, language barriers, and unforeseen events may complicate travel logistics.


#### 5. **Policy Compliance and Risk Management**


For many companies, having strict travel policies in place is essential for controlling costs and maintaining consistency across business operations. A business travel agency can help ensure compliance with these policies by making bookings that align with your company’s rules and guidelines, such as preferred airlines, hotels, or class of service.


In addition to policy compliance, travel agencies can also play a role in risk management. They can monitor the security situation of a destination, advise on health precautions, and provide valuable information about any risks that may affect your employees. By helping your business stay informed about potential travel hazards, a business travel agency ensures the safety and security of employees during their trips.


#### 6. **Customizable Services**


Every business has different travel needs, and a one-size-fits-all approach doesn’t always work. A professional travel agency understands this and can offer customizable solutions tailored to your company’s unique requirements. Whether your company has frequent international travelers, remote workers, or specific preferences for accommodations, a travel agency can adapt to your needs and create a personalized travel program.


Customizable services may include corporate accounts, travel tracking systems, and tailored reports, allowing businesses to gain insights into their travel spending and travel patterns. This enables you to make data-driven decisions about travel policies and budgets.


#### 7. **Technology Integration**


Modern business travel agencies leverage technology to enhance the customer experience and improve efficiency. With integrated travel management platforms, businesses can easily book and manage travel arrangements, track expenses, and view travel itineraries from any device, anywhere.


These platforms also offer a variety of features, including automated booking options, real-time notifications, expense tracking, and reporting tools that provide visibility into travel spending and trends. The ability to track all travel-related data in one place makes it easier for businesses to analyze and optimize their travel programs.


### Choosing the Right Business Travel Agency


When selecting a business travel agency, it’s essential to consider a few key factors to ensure you find the right fit for your company. Here are some things to keep in mind:


1. **Experience and Reputation**  

   Choose a travel agency with extensive experience in corporate travel management. A reputable agency will have a proven track record of handling the unique demands of business travel and will be able to provide references from other companies in your industry.


2. **Range of Services**  

   Not all business travel agencies offer the same level of service. Consider whether the agency provides the specific services your business needs, such as international travel, corporate account management, or risk management services.


3. **Technology and Tools**  

   Look for an agency that uses cutting-edge technology to streamline the booking and management process. A robust travel management platform can significantly improve efficiency and give you greater control over your company’s travel arrangements.


4. **Cost and Pricing Structure**  

   Compare the pricing structures of different agencies to ensure you’re getting good value for your investment. Some agencies charge a flat fee, while others may work on a commission basis. Make sure to clarify pricing before entering into a contract to avoid any hidden costs.


5. **Customer Service and Support**  

   The level of customer support provided by the agency is crucial, especially when dealing with last-minute changes or travel disruptions. Look for an agency that offers 24/7 customer support and has a reputation for handling issues quickly and professionally.
